Our course is currently being piloted with 14 students across 2 Brooklyn middle schools in a hybrid classroom setup.
We had the opportunity to observe the optional orientation session on Monday, 5/9. We will get some more feedback when the results from the pre-course survey have been analyzed. We took notes of some strengths and some potential areas for growth for future lessons and implementations, and we will highlight a few of them here:
Students seemed to really like the icebreaker activity where they could say their favorite games. That built a sense of community when discussion arose about different games they've all played.
14 students currently registered- strong numbers
Activities worked with using the Zoom chat, students being in person, and students online.
For this implementation, each session is 2 hours long (not 1, like we planned for), so a few activities had to be added
From the six students who attended this optional first session, only one student used she/her pronouns- the registration is mostly boys
